before.json
after.json
Clique em Comparar para executar o diff.

Relacionado

Guias para Diff

Todos os guias →

Como funciona o JSON Diff

Cole dois documentos JSON (ou YAML) e obtenha uma comparação lado a lado instantânea. Ambos os documentos são parseados e reserializados com chaves ordenadas antes do diff, portanto diferenças na ordem das chaves não geram falsos positivos —— apenas mudanças reais de valor ficam destacadas.

Use como ferramenta de jsondiff, json compare online ou compare json online para respostas de API, testes de snapshot, fixtures ou payloads de webhook. Compare json : identifique de um relance a diferença entre duas versões do mesmo documento.

  • Visão lado a lado —— linhas removidas à esquerda, adicionadas à direita, inalteradas no centro
  • Métricas de resumo —— quantidade de campos adicionados, removidos, alterados e inalterados de relance
  • JSON e YAML —— alterne o formato para comparar documentos YAML
  • Ordem das chaves ignorada —— {"a":1,"b":2} e {"b":2,"a":1} são tratados como iguais

FAQ

Por que dois documentos — um ordenado e outro não — são considerados iguais?

Porque, pela especificação, objetos JSON não têm ordem. Este diff normaliza as chaves antes da comparação, portanto {"a":1,"b":2} e {"b":2,"a":1} são equivalentes —— só as diferenças reais de valor ficam destacadas.